Conventional laser enclosures may not be durable enough to withstand prolonged laser exposure. Lasermet’s Active Guarding Systems shut off the laser immediately in the event of stray laser radiation hitting the enclosure.
Lasermet’s Active Enclosure is a laser safety cabin fitted with an Active Guarding system – Laser Jailer®. These modular, Class 1, room-sized enclosures are tested and certified to international laser safety standards and can be rapidly designed, built, and installed by Lasermet.

The Glaser Jailer by Lasermet is a fail-safe active laser safety window that enables high-powered lasers to be switched off virtually immediately if the laser beam inadvertently strikes the window. It is suitable for all laser powers, wavelengths, and waveforms. The Glaser Jailer isolates the laser safety input within 50ms of an inadvertent laser window strike, rendering the laser safe.
The Laser Jailer combines an inherently fail-safe laser detection technique and Lasermet’s proven laser Interlock® control system technology to create an active laser guarding system conforming to Machinery Directive Standard EN 13849-1.
